Termux: A comprehensive guide to the versatile mobile terminal emulator

Introduction

Termux is a powerful and versatile terminal emulator app for Android devices that provides users with a command-line environment similar to that of a Linux system. It allows users to run a wide range of command-line tools, scripts, and programs on their Android devices, making it an ideal tool for developers, system administrators, and anyone who needs a robust terminal environment on the go.

Installation and Setup

Termux is available for free on the Google Play Store. Once installed, it requires minimal setup. Upon opening the app for the first time, users are presented with a command-line interface similar to a Linux terminal. Termux comes pre-installed with a basic set of command-line tools, including Bash, Nano, and Python.

Key Features

Termux offers a wide range of features that make it a compelling tool for advanced users. These features include:

  • Extensive package management: Termux provides access to a vast repository of packages that can be easily installed and managed through the command line using the "pkg" command.
  • Full Linux environment: Termux emulates a complete Linux environment, allowing users to run a wide range of software tools and applications that are typically only available on Linux systems.
  • Script execution: Termux supports the execution of shell scripts and other types of scripts, making it easy to automate tasks or perform complex operations on the device.
  • File management: The app provides access to the device's file system, allowing users to create, edit, and manage files and directories directly from the command line.
  • Customization: Termux offers extensive customization options, including the ability to change the theme, keyboard layout, and other settings to suit individual preferences.

Uses and Applications

Termux has a wide range of uses and applications, including:

  • Software development: Termux can be used for software development, testing, and debugging on Android devices, providing a powerful environment for developers.
  • System administration: IT professionals can use Termux to perform system administration tasks such as monitoring system logs, managing files, and troubleshooting issues remotely.
  • Education: Termux is an excellent tool for teaching and learning about Linux and command-line tools in an accessible and portable environment.
  • Automation: Termux can be used to automate tasks such as file management, system configuration, and data processing using shell scripts.
  • Security testing: Security professionals can use Termux to perform security testing and vulnerability assessments on Android devices.

Advantages of Termux

Termux offers several advantages over other terminal emulator apps, including:

  • Open source: Termux is an open-source project, which means that it is freely available for anyone to use, modify, and distribute.
  • Cross-platform compatibility: Termux is available for a wide range of Android devices, making it accessible to a large user base.
  • Regular updates: Termux receives regular updates that add new features and improve stability.
  • Large community: Termux has a large and active community of users who provide support and contribute to the project's development.
